问答网首页 > 网络技术 > 电商 > 电商商品如何存储es(电商商品存储难题:如何有效管理海量数据?)
 嘻哈风 嘻哈风
电商商品如何存储es(电商商品存储难题:如何有效管理海量数据?)
电商商品如何存储ES? 电商商品的存储是一个复杂且关键的环节,涉及到商品信息的完整性、安全性以及高效性。在电子商务中,商品信息通常包括产品描述、价格、库存量、用户评价等关键数据。为了确保这些信息的安全和可用性,电商企业通常会使用ELASTICSEARCH(简称ES)来存储和管理这些数据。以下是电商商品如何存储ES的详细步骤: 数据导入: 首先,需要将商品数据从其他数据库或系统中导入到ELASTICSEARCH中。这可以通过编写脚本或使用现有的ETL工具来完成。 索引创建: 在导入数据之前,需要为每个商品创建一个索引。索引是ES中的一个文档集合,用于存储特定类型的数据。例如,如果一个商品有多个属性,如名称、价格和库存数量,那么可以为此商品创建一个名为“PRODUCT”的索引。 字段映射: 在创建索引时,需要定义每个字段的类型和映射。例如,如果商品名称是文本类型,价格是数字类型,库存数量是整数类型,那么可以在索引中定义相应的字段类型。 数据分片: 为了提高搜索性能,可以将索引分成多个分片。每个分片包含一定数量的文档,并且可以跨多个节点分布。这样可以提高搜索速度并减少单个节点的压力。 监控和维护: 定期监控ES的性能和健康状况,以确保数据的正确性和完整性。此外,还需要定期维护索引和分片,以保持数据的一致性和准确性。 安全和权限管理: 确保只有授权的用户才能访问和修改ES中的文档。这可以通过设置访问控制列表(ACL)来实现。 数据备份和恢复: 定期备份ES中的数据,以防数据丢失或损坏。同时,也需要制定数据恢复计划,以便在发生故障时能够迅速恢复数据。 通过以上步骤,电商企业可以有效地使用ELASTICSEARCH来存储和管理商品数据,从而提高搜索效率、保证数据的准确性和安全性。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

电商相关问答

  • 2026-01-27 如何关闭电商推荐广告(如何有效关闭电商推荐广告?)

    要关闭电商推荐广告,您可以按照以下步骤操作: 打开您常用的电商平台或购物网站。 进入您的账户设置或个人资料页面。 查找“隐私设置”、“账号安全”或“账户信息”等相关选项。 在相关设置中,找到与广告相关的部分。 选择“关...

  • 2026-01-27 如何学习易语电商(如何有效学习易语电商?)

    学习易语电商是一个系统的过程,涉及多个方面的知识和技能。以下是一些建议,可以帮助你更好地学习易语电商: 了解易语电商的基本概念:首先,你需要了解易语电商是什么,它的特点和优势。这包括了解易语电商的发展历程、主要业务模...

  • 2026-01-27 日本跨境电商如何登录(如何成功登录日本跨境电商平台?)

    要登录日本跨境电商平台,您需要遵循以下步骤: 访问目标跨境电商平台的网站或应用。例如,如果您想登录亚马逊(AMAZON JAPAN),您需要访问AMAZON.CO.JP。 输入您的用户名和密码。通常,您需要在注册...